Durability in a sandal comes from several interconnected elements. The quality of the materials used for the upper determines how well it resists UV damage, moisture, and the friction of regular use. The construction method used to attach the sole, whether it is stitched, cemented, or a combination, determines how long it holds before separating. And the density and composition of the outsole rubber determines how slowly it wears down with pavement use.
Walking sandals built for longevity use premium materials at every level. Genuine leather uppers that are properly treated resist breakdown far longer than synthetic alternatives. Stitched or combination constructions outlast purely cemented soles significantly. And high-density rubber outsoles wear slowly and maintain their grip properties across thousands of kilometres of use.

Even well-made sandals benefit from basic care that extends their life further. For leather sandals, occasional cleaning with appropriate leather cleaner and conditioning with leather conditioner maintains the flexibility and appearance of the upper. For synthetic materials, a simple wipe down with a damp cloth after use removes dirt and salt residue that degrades materials over time.

Quality sandals often can be repaired when they begin to show wear, particularly on the sole. A cobbler can resole well-made sandals at a fraction of the cost of a new pair, extending the life of a sandal you love for additional seasons. This option simply does not exist for cheap sandals where the construction does not allow for repair.
